Analysis
In 2024, meat indigenous, total — gross production value in Caribbean stood at 2.56 million 1000 Int$.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 2.2% on the previous year and down 9.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, meat indigenous, total — gross production value in Caribbean peaked at 3.05 million 1000 Int$ in 2016 and was at its lowest, 1.22 million 1000 Int$, in 1961.
Caribbean ranks 27th of 29 groups on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 64 years of available data.

About this data
The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
